Output 3fb24251e8eaa996cb3402be3560215d644e92511f90be7811741ad18e335b9a:3

value
615263
script pubkey
OP_0 OP_PUSHBYTES_20 75a638bfa2a7a255588588af2dee3bb54dd28bd7
address
tb1qwknr30az57392ky93zhjmm3mk4xa9z7h3mh27m
transaction
3fb24251e8eaa996cb3402be3560215d644e92511f90be7811741ad18e335b9a